Abstract

This study aims to obtain empirical evidence about the effect of investment opportunity set, debt policy, and firm size on dividend policy. The population in the study are mining companies listed on the Indonesia Stock Exchange (IDX) in the period 2015-2017. Samples collected using purposive sampling method. A total of 14 (fourteen) companies were selected as samples. Types of associative research and testing tools using SPSS 20. The influence on the independent variable investment opportunity set, debt policy, and company size simultaneously influence dividend policy. Meanwhile, the investment opportunity set and debt policy have a positive influence on dividend policy. While the size of the company has a negative influence on dividend policy. The results of the coefficient of determination show that 75,10% of the remaining 24,10% is explained by other variables not included in this study
